About this Dog
Charity was found with Faith living under an abandoned house. They were rescued and taken to a shelter where they were moved to a foster home. It has taken Charity a while to not be afraid of people. But thanks to the loving home she has been in, she is coming out of her shell. She is still a bit unsure, so she comes across as being shy. But behind that shyness is a very sweet deserving girl. Charity has those soft brown eyes that beseech you to love her. She has a short black and white coat. Though her sweet lovable face is totally black, her chest is all white as is the tip of her tail and her paws. She weighs about 25 pounds and is probably 2 years of age. She is considered full grown. Charity is listed as a terrier mix which opens up all kinds of possibilities as to exactly what that means. One thing for sure, she is a survivor. She is perfectly comfortable and friendly with other dogs. She has been living with kids and still can be a little shy until she reaches a comfort level. With a family that will accept and love her, Charity will continue to grow and become more confident. She has a medium amount of energy so she would benefit from play time and walks around the block. Her foster mom has been working with her on her crate, leash, and house training. She is making progress in these areas and will need to continue working on these skills with someone who has the patience, time, and energy. It will require the right guidance but the result will be a dog that will be a devoted lifelong companion. Charity also will need to work on socialization skills so that she will continue to build her confidence.
